Job Summary:

We are seeking an experienced Planning Engineer with a strong background in civil and landscape projects to join our team in the UAE. The ideal candidate will have a minimum of 4 years of experience in project planning, scheduling, and progress tracking, with the ability to effectively manage timelines, resources, and deliverables. The Planning Engineer will play a pivotal role in ensuring the successful and timely completion of civil and landscape projects while adhering to quality standards and client expectations.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Project Planning & Scheduling:

Develop, update, and maintain comprehensive project schedules for civil and landscape projects. Ensure that all project milestones, deliverables, and deadlines are accurately reflected in the schedule.

  • Resource Allocation:

Coordinate and allocate resources (materials, manpower, and equipment) efficiently to ensure the smooth progression of the project. Monitor the availability and utilization of resources and address any shortages or delays.

  • Progress Monitoring & Reporting:

Track project progress against the baseline schedule and prepare regular progress reports for project managers and stakeholders. Identify any potential delays or risks and provide recommendations for corrective actions.

  • Coordination with Project Teams:

Collaborate closely with the project management team, engineers, subcontractors, and consultants to ensure the project schedule is adhered to. Facilitate regular meetings to review project status and resolve scheduling issues.

  • Critical Path Analysis:

Perform critical path analysis to identify key tasks and potential bottlenecks. Ensure that any delays in critical activities are mitigated and managed efficiently to avoid impacting the overall project timeline.

  • Contractual Milestones & Claims Management:

Ensure that all contractual milestones are met in accordance with the project schedule. Assist in the preparation of claims and variations related to delays or disruptions.

  • Risk Management:

Identify and assess potential risks to the project schedule and work with the project team to develop mitigation strategies. Proactively manage delays and disruptions to maintain the project timeline.

  • Document Control:

Ensure that all planning-related documents, schedules, and reports are properly documented and stored in accordance with company procedures. Maintain up-to-date records of project progress and any changes to the plan.

  • Collaboration with Stakeholders:

Liaise with clients, consultants, contractors, and suppliers to ensure alignment with the project schedule and resolve any scheduling conflicts or issues.
